Sensu is a flexible and scalable monitoring solution that helps organizations manage and monitor their infrastructure in real time. In this guide, we will walk through the steps to install Sensu on Ubuntu 22.04. Whether you're setting it up on a local server or using a Windows VPS UK solution, this tutorial will guide you through the process.

Step 1: Update Your System

Before installing Sensu, ensure that your system is up to date by running the following commands:

sudo apt update && sudo apt upgrade

Keeping your system updated ensures you have the latest security patches and software versions, whether you're using a local machine or a UK Windows VPS.

Step 2: Install Sensu Backend

Sensu has a backend service that handles the management of your monitoring environment. To install the Sensu backend, first add the Sensu repository and import its GPG key:


wget -q https://packagecloud.io/sensu/stable/gpgkey -O- | sudo apt-key add -
echo "deb https://packagecloud.io/sensu/stable/ubuntu/ jammy main" | sudo tee /etc/apt/sources.list.d/sensu.list
sudo apt update
            

Now, install the Sensu backend:

sudo apt install sensu-go-backend

After installation, start the Sensu backend and enable it to start at boot:


sudo systemctl start sensu-backend
sudo systemctl enable sensu-backend
            

Whether you are running Sensu locally or on a Windows VPS hosting UK platform, this backend will manage your monitoring environment.

Step 3: Configure Sensu Backend

Now, let’s configure the Sensu backend. First, you need to create an administrator user. Run the following command to create the admin user:


sensu-backend init --interactive
            

You will be prompted to set up the admin username and password. These credentials will be used to log into the Sensu dashboard later.

Step 4: Install Sensu Agent

Sensu agents are installed on the systems you want to monitor. To install the Sensu agent, run the following command:

sudo apt install sensu-go-agent

After installation, configure the Sensu agent by editing the configuration file:

sudo nano /etc/sensu/agent.yml

Add the following details to the file:


backend-url: "ws://127.0.0.1:8081"
name: "agent-name"
subscriptions:
  - system
            

Replace agent-name with a unique name for your agent. Then start and enable the Sensu agent:


sudo systemctl start sensu-agent
sudo systemctl enable sensu-agent
            

Whether you're monitoring servers on a local network or in a VPS Windows Servers setup, these agents will communicate with the backend to provide real-time monitoring.

Step 5: Access the Sensu Web UI

The Sensu Web UI allows you to manage and visualize your infrastructure’s health. You can access it by navigating to http://your-server-ip:3000 in your browser.

Log in using the admin credentials you set up earlier. From here, you can monitor your system's performance and manage your infrastructure. This interface is accessible from anywhere, whether hosted on a local machine or in a UK VPS Windows environment.

Step 6: Monitor Your Infrastructure with Sensu

Once logged into the Sensu Web UI, you can configure checks, set up alerts, and monitor your infrastructure in real time. Sensu supports a wide range of plugins and checks, allowing you to monitor various services and metrics across your servers. This level of flexibility makes Sensu an ideal choice for environments hosted on Windows Virtual Private Servers or other scalable hosting solutions.

Sensu provides a robust and scalable monitoring solution for your infrastructure. If you're looking for reliable hosting options to deploy Sensu, consider using Windows VPS UK. They offer a variety of windows vps hosting options, including virtual private server hosting windows, windows virtual private server hosting, and windows virtual dedicated server hosting to meet your needs, whether you’re running a small setup or a large infrastructure.

Was dit antwoord nuttig? 0 gebruikers vonden dit artikel nuttig (0 Stemmen)